Sol–gel preparation of low oxygen content, high surface area silicon nitride and imidonitride materials?

Dalton Transactions Pub Date: 2016-02-24 DOI: 10.1039/C5DT04961J

Abstract

Reactions of Si(NHMe)4 with ammonia are effectively catalysed by small ammonium triflate concentrations, and can be used to produce free-standing silicon imide gels. Firing at various temperatures produces amorphous or partially crystallised silicon imidonitride/nitride samples with high surface areas and low oxygen contents. The crystalline phase is entirely α-Si3N4 and structural similarities are observed between the amorphous and crystallised materials.
